Jungho Cho is a researcher at the forefront of advanced manufacturing and materials engineering, with a primary focus on wire arc additive manufacturing (WAAM) and functional composite materials. His most impactful work, "Parameter Optimization of WAAM with Pulsed GMAW for Manufacturing Propeller-Shaped Blade" (2023), has garnered 18 citations, demonstrating its significance in optimizing process parameters for complex, high-value marine components. This contribution addresses critical challenges in large-scale metal additive manufacturing, offering practical solutions for industrial applications. Additionally, Cho’s exploration of "Development of Epoxy-Based Flexible Electrical Conductor" (2023) highlights his versatility in bridging structural and functional materials, with potential implications for wearable electronics and smart structures.
